**Unlocking New Possibilities with Collaborative Robotics**
Collaborative robots, or cobots, represent a significant shift in the robotics landscape. Traditional industrial robots were typically confined to cages for safety reasons, operating away from human interaction. However, collaborative robots like YuMi® are changing the game by working side by side with human operators. This seamless collaboration ensures increased productivity, as human workers and robots can now focus on their respective strengths and work together to tackle complex tasks.

**Safe Collaboration in Industrial Robots Applications**
ABB’s YuMi® has always prioritized safety while collaborating with its human counterparts. It is equipped with advanced sensors and vision systems that allow it to detect the presence of humans and adjust its movements accordingly. This ensures a safe working environment, reducing the risk of accidents and injuries.
